Delayed rooting hormone application and stem cutting collection time improved Flacourtia indica rooting ability and root growth

Abstract Flacourtia indica is an important fruit and medicinal tree in southern Africa but has a low seed germination. Assessing rooting ability of mature (fruit bearing) F. indica stem cuttings is vital to attain early fruiting. The objectives were to assess responses of mature stem cuttings to different application time of a rooting hormone (Seradix® No. 2) and stem cutting collection time and to identify important pheno-phases of in F. indica yearly tree growth cycle. A significantly higher rooting percentage (P < 0.001) was obtained with delayed Seradix® No. 2 application than immediate application. Stem cuttings collected at flowering and leaf fall seasons were responsive to Seradix® No. 2 application, but all stem cuttings collected at fruiting time failed to produce roots. Stem cuttings significantly (P = 0.0482) produced more roots with immediate Seradix® No. 2 application than those subjected to delayed Seradix® No. 2 application for stem cuttings collected at flowering period. The failure to produce roots for cuttings collected at fruiting time could be due to low sugars (carbohydrates) in the stem cuttings. It is concluded that the best time to collect mature stem cuttings for rooting is either at flowering or leaf fall period and that delayed Seradix® No. 2 application improves rooting of mature F. indica stem cuttings.
